UK Parliament · Public Bill · No. 3365
Sale of Tobacco (Licensing) Bill
[As Introduced]
A
BILL
to
This bill would require anyone selling tobacco (cigarettes, cigars, etc.) to get a special licence from the government first. Only licensed sellers would legally be allowed to sell tobacco, similar to how alcohol sales are controlled through licensing systems.
Presented by Bob Blackman.
